2017 RUB to GYD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2017

During 2017, the RUB to GYD ex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on March 30, valuing the pair at 3.7338.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on January 3, dropping to 3.3751.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.3588 GYD.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 3.4646 to the December average rate of 3.5326, the exchange rate registered a net change of 1.96% (reflecting a strengthening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2017 high of 3.7338 was up 9.04% compared to the 2016 peak of 3.4243,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.
